done: What most religions don’t tell you about the Bible by Cary Schmidt – ISBN-10: 1598940066
This book sets out the gospel message and explains it easily, the “gospel”, or “good news”, being that Jesus has died and risen to pay the price for humanity’s sins and to defeat death. The author explains this message using clear speech and ample analogies and examples, stories that connect to people’s lives or imaginations. This style is, really, similar to Jesus himself explaining his message by telling stories (parables) that connected to the people’s daily lives. For those who are seeking and have questions about Christianity, for those who are new Christians, and for Christians who have become weighed down by being taught or otherwise coming to believe that they must be good and add good works to their faith or else God will no longer be pleased with or love them, this book could be very helpful as a starting point. For other Christians, it can be an encouragement, a reminder, or a source to use with their friends who might have questions. – Review by Sara Juveland

Ancient Church Fathers: What the Disciples of the Apostles taught – by Ken Johnson – ISBN-10: 1452868565
The Ancient Church Fathers reveals the disciples of the twelve apostles, and what they taught, from their own writings. It documents that the same doctrine was faithfully transmitted to their descendants in the first few centuries. It also describes where, when, and by whom, the doctrines began to change. The ancient church fathers make it very easy to know for sure what the complete teachings of Jesus and the twelve apostles were. You will learn, from their own writings, what the first century disciples taught about the various doctrines that divide our church today. You will learn what was discussed at the Seven General Councils and why. You will learn about the cults and cult leaders who began to change doctrine and spread their heresy. And you will learn how those heresies became the standard teaching in the medieval church.

The Case for Christ by Lee Strobel – ISBN-10: 0310209307
Retracing his own spiritual journey from atheism to faith, Lee Strobel, former legal editor of the Chicago Tribune, cross-examines a dozen experts with doctorates from schools like Cambridge, Princeton, and Brandeis who are recognized authorities in their own fields. Strobel challenges them with questions like: How reliable is the New Testament? Does evidence for Jesus exist outside the Bible? Is there any reason to believe the resurrection was an actual event?
